Job Description
We are looking for a dedicated Virtual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) to join our team and provide crucial speech therapy services to K-12 students in Florida for the remainder of the 2024-2025 school year. This is a fully remote position, allowing you to work from the comfort of your home while making a meaningful impact on students' speech and language development through teletherapy.
As a Virtual SLP, you'll assess and treat speech and language disorders, create individualized therapy plans, and work closely with educational teams—all through a user-friendly, secure online platform. You'll also have access to a variety of resources to enhance your therapy sessions and a supportive team to help you with everything from therapy strategies to technical platform assistance.
Key Responsibilities:
Provide virtual speech therapy to K-12 students within a Florida school district using a secure online platform.
Conduct speech assessments, create personalized treatment plans, and implement interventions for students with speech and language challenges.
Keep accurate and up-to-date records of therapy sessions, student progress, and modifications to treatment plans.
Collaborate with teachers, school staff, and parents to track student progress and adjust therapy as needed.
Use digital tools and resources to deliver engaging virtual lessons and exercises that enhance student participation.
Stay informed on best practices in teletherapy and speech-language pathology, adapting them effectively for a virtual environment.

Qualifications:
Master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ology.
Active state licensure as a Speech-Language Pathologist in Florida.
ASHA certification (CCC-SLP) is preferred, but not required.
Previous experience working with K-12 students in a school setting is preferred.
Experience or comfort with teletherapy or using online platforms for therapy is a plus.
Strong organizational, communication, and time-management skills.
Ability to create an engaging and supportive virtual environment for students using digital tools and resources.
